How to Protect Furniture from Dogs: Tips for a Dog-Friendly Home
As much as we love our furry companions, they can sometimes leave a lasting mark on our furniture. Whether it’s shedding fur, muddy paw prints, or the occasional scratch, dogs can be tough on your beloved couches, chairs, and other furniture. The good news is that there are effective ways to protect your furniture while still allowing your dog to roam freely. In this blog, we’ll provide you with practical and easy tips to protect your furniture from dogs and keep your home looking beautiful.
1. Invest in Dog-Friendly Furniture
When it comes to protecting your furniture, choosing the right fabric is key. Opt for materials that are durable, easy to clean, and resistant to pet damage. Here are some dog-friendly fabrics you can consider:
- Microfiber/Microsuede: Microfiber is soft and smooth, making it resistant to dog hair and easy to clean. It’s an affordable option that can hold up well against stains and pet messes.
- Leather or Faux Leather: Leather is a durable material that resists scratches, stains, and spills. It also doesn’t trap pet hair, making it easier to wipe clean.
- Performance Fabrics: These fabrics are specially designed to withstand wear and tear, making them a great option for pet owners. They are resistant to moisture, stains, and shedding, and are generally easy to maintain.
For those who are unsure about reupholstering, using slipcovers or pet-friendly throws can be a quick and effective solution.
2. Use Furniture Covers and Slipcovers
One of the easiest ways to protect your furniture from dogs is by using slipcovers or furniture covers. These can be easily removed and washed if your dog sheds hair or has an accident. Slipcovers provide an added layer of protection for your couch or chairs, ensuring that your furniture stays in good condition while still being comfy for your pup.
Look for slipcovers made from durable fabrics like denim, cotton, or polyester that are specifically designed to withstand pet wear. Additionally, these slipcovers often come with elastic bands or adjustable straps to ensure they stay securely in place.
3. Create a Designated Dog Area
One of the best ways to keep your furniture safe is by creating a designated space for your dog to relax and sleep. A dog bed or crate provides a comfortable and safe resting place, reducing the likelihood of your dog jumping on your furniture.

4. Train Your Dog to Stay Off Furniture
Training your dog to stay off the furniture is another way to protect your beloved pieces. With consistent training and positive reinforcement, your dog can learn to stay off your couches and chairs.
Start by setting boundaries and providing an alternative, such as a comfy dog bed or mat, where your dog can rest. If they do get on the furniture, gently redirect them to their bed. Always reward good behavior and make the dog bed a desirable spot with toys or treats.
5. Use Pet-Safe Furniture Protectors
Pet-safe furniture protectors are an excellent addition to your home if you want to keep your furniture clean. These are often clear, adhesive protectors that are designed to shield the furniture from scratches, claw marks, and stains. Some protectors are made specifically to cover the arms, back, and seats of your couch or chairs, helping to minimize any damage caused by your dog’s paws or claws.
These protectors are easy to apply and can be removed or replaced as needed. Additionally, they won’t interfere with the look of your furniture, providing an invisible layer of protection.
6. Trim Your Dog’s Nails Regularly
Regular nail trimming is essential for both your dog’s health and the longevity of your furniture. Long nails can easily scratch the fabric and leather on your furniture. Keeping your dog’s nails trimmed and filed helps reduce the chances of them causing damage when they jump or climb onto the couch.
Make nail trimming part of your dog’s grooming routine, and remember to reward them for good behavior during the process.
7. Protect Furniture with Throw Blankets
If your dog likes to lounge on the couch, consider draping a throw blanket over the furniture. Not only does it provide extra protection from fur and dirt, but it also makes cleaning up easier. When your dog sheds fur or gets dirty, simply remove the blanket and wash it.
Choose blankets made of durable, washable fabrics like fleece or cotton for easy care. These blankets can also serve as an extra layer of comfort for your pup when they’re relaxing on the couch.
8. Wipe Down Furniture After Walks
Regularly wipe down your furniture to keep it free from dirt, mud, and other outdoor debris. If you’ve been on a walk or outing with your dog, make sure to wipe their paws and coat before letting them jump on the furniture. This simple step can help maintain the cleanliness of your home and prevent dirt or mud from transferring to your furniture.
9. Regularly Vacuum Pet Hair
Pet hair is one of the most common issues dog owners face when it comes to protecting their furniture. Investing in a good vacuum with a pet hair attachment can help keep your furniture clean. Regular vacuuming will remove dog hair, dirt, and other debris from your furniture.
You can also use a lint roller or a pet hair removal brush for quick touch-ups on your couch or chairs.
10. Keep Your Dog’s Hygiene in Check
Good hygiene plays a key role in preventing damage to your furniture. Regular bathing, ear cleaning, and brushing will help reduce the amount of shedding and dirt your dog brings inside. Additionally, using a pet-friendly shampoo and cleaning products can keep your dog’s coat fresh and minimize odors.
